About 5-fluoro-2-N-methylpyridine-2,3-diamine

5-fluoro-2-N-methylpyridine-2,3-diamine (PubChem CID 84648615) has the molecular formula C6H8FN3 and a molecular weight of 141.15 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 5-fluoro-2-N-methylpyridine-2,3-diamine.
